Leartin

Quote from: jamespetts on January 26, 2016, 11:42:29 AM
Also, I wonder whether it is time to replace the orange title bars with another colour, as orange does not go well with blue. Yellow, perhaps? They are opposite on the colour wheel.

In r7373 (version I smuggled on the work pc) the parameters "front_window_bar_color" and "bottom_window_bar_color" accept values other than 0-6 for different colors, even though they don't accept RGB values - and only in the theme tab, not in the ingame settings menu. Also, they are not identical with the normal color indizes... But in principal it is possible to change the titlebar color, so if it isn't already that should be made an supported part of themes, thus allowing for any fiiting color to be chosen.
